About
Samar is a prominent bus company based in Spain, with over 85 years of experience in road passenger transport. They operate a significant number of bus and coach routes, primarily in Madrid, Seville, and Zaragoza, but also offer national and international services. Samar is known for its reliability, punctuality, and commitment to passenger satisfaction, maintaining a modern fleet of around 600 vehicles. Beyond regular passenger transport, Samar also provides bus and coach rental services for various occasions. Many of their newer vehicles offer amenities such as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power outlets.

About
Alsa is the main provider of bus travel in Spain and a subsidiary of the UK’s National Express. It operates an extensive network of regional, national, and international routes, transporting more than 300 million passengers annually. Alsa’s modern fleet offers varying levels of comfort and amenities. The standard Alsa Normal buses include free Wi-Fi, onboard bathrooms, footrests, and entertainment. For a more premium experience, Alsa Supra, Alsa Eurobus, and Alsa Premium services provide enhanced comfort and luxury features.

About
BlaBlaCar is a French online marketplace for carpooling, connecting drivers with empty seats and passengers traveling to the same destination to share costs. Founded in 2006, it operates in Europe and Latin America, boasting 26 million active members. The platform also includes BlaBlaCar Bus, an intercity bus service. BlaBlaCar's name comes from its rating system for drivers' chattiness: "Bla" for quiet, "BlaBla" for talkative, and "BlaBlaBla" for very chatty. The company aims to be the leading marketplace for shared travel, offering affordable and sustainable solutions by combining carpooling with bus journeys.
